Our kidneys help to remove waste products from the blood, particularly nitrogen containing compounds. These we produce as a result of eating protein, but the body has little use for the spare Nitrogen compounds. The kidneys also keep the sodium and potassium levels in the balance the body needs. This organ occurs very early in evolution. Nephridia appear in simple worms and have this function.

Hematopoiesis or hemopoiesis is the process by which all blood cells are formed.
hematopoiesis is the formation of blood cells which happens red bone marrow. red bone marrow is found in flat bones. the sternum(a flat bone) is a major site for hematopoiesis
